Subject[ 01/56] UBIFS: fix compilation warning
Date
3.4-stable review patch.  If anyone has any objections, please let me know.

------------------

From: Alexandre Pereira da Silva <aletes.xgr@gmail.com>

commit 782759b9f5f5223e0962af60c3457c912fab755f upstream.

Fix the following compilation warning:

fs/ubifs/dir.c: In function 'ubifs_rename':
fs/ubifs/dir.c:972:15: warning: 'saved_nlink' may be used uninitialized
in this function

Use the 'uninitialized_var()' macro to get rid of this false-positive.
